Role Overview

The Senior Area Sales Executive - General Trade (Laos) will lead and manage the distributor sales team within an assigned territory. The role focuses on driving sales growth, ensuring excellent product distribution and visibility, maximizing territory coverage, and increasing market share.

This role requires strong leadership, solid business and sales acumen, and a deep understanding of working capital, ROI, and FMCG operations.

Key Responsibilities:

1. Sales Strategy & Execution

  • Implement effective sales strategies by translating CD priorities and company strategies into excellent execution.
  • Set and manage sales targets for assigned distributors.
  • Guide and support distributor sales teams in identifying opportunities, negotiating, and closing deals.
  • Conduct regular market visits to review availability, visibility, and promotional execution.
  • Monitor sales activation and support MDM programs to boost brand penetration and market share.
  • Analyze market data, trends, and opportunities across channels and categories.

2. Team Management & Development

  • Work with distributor partners to recruit, train, and motivate sales teams.
  • Set clear KPIs and conduct performance evaluations.
  • Provide coaching and constructive feedback to improve effectiveness.
  • Build a positive, collaborative working culture.

3. Customer Relationship Management

  • Build and maintain strong relationships with key customers and business partners.
  • Address customer issues promptly to maintain satisfaction.
  • Stay informed on market trends, customer needs, and competitor activities to identify new opportunities.

4. Territory & Outlet Management

  • Develop and execute outlet coverage plans (direct & controlled stores).
  • Ensure proper routing (PJP) and visit frequency for distributor sales reps.
  • Strengthen sales fundamentals through FCS (Field Capability Score) improvement.

5. Reporting, ROI & Working Capital

  • Prepare accurate sales forecasts, promotional plans, and daily/weekly/monthly reports.
  • Analyze data to identify gaps and propose actionable solutions.
  • Participate in monthly business reviews with distributor partners.
  • Support RSMs with ROI and working capital analysis to ensure profitability and healthy cash flow.
